Only just realised today that #GGST overdrives don't seem to require the diagonal inputs in them.Ram's hcb, f+H can be done as f,d,b,f+HHer qcfx2+S can be done as d,f,d,f+SSecond input is useful as qcf+S requires the diagonal input, and so won't come out accidentally.— Necromancy Black (@NecromancyBlack) February 22, 2021
